fn set_atom_op(&mut self, range: Range<usize>, atom_op: AtomOp) {
assert!(range.len() == 4);
self.set_field(
range,
match atom_op {
AtomOp::Add => 0_u8,
AtomOp::Min => 1_u8,
AtomOp::Max => 2_u8,
AtomOp::Inc => 3_u8,
AtomOp::Dec => 4_u8,
AtomOp::And => 5_u8,
AtomOp::Or => 6_u8,
AtomOp::Xor => 7_u8,
AtomOp::Exch => 8_u8,
AtomOp::CmpExch => panic!("CmpXchg not yet supported"),
},
);
}
fn encode_atomg(&mut self, op: &OpAtom) {
self.set_opcode(0xed00);
self.set_mem_order(&op.mem_order);
self.set_dst(op.dst);
self.set_reg_src(8..16, op.addr);
self.set_reg_src(20..28, op.data);
self.set_field(28..48, op.addr_offset);
self.set_field(
48..49,
match op.mem_space.addr_type() {
MemAddrType::A32 => 0_u8,
MemAddrType::A64 => 1_u8,
},
);
self.set_field(
49..52,
match op.atom_type {
AtomType::U32 => 0_u8,
AtomType::I32 => 1_u8,
AtomType::U64 => 2_u8,
AtomType::F32 => 3_u8,
/* NOTE: U128 => 4_u8, */
AtomType::I64 => 5_u8,
/* TODO: do something about ATOMG.F64 */
other => panic!("ATOMG.{other} not supported on SM50"),
},
);
self.set_atom_op(52..56, op.atom_op);
}
fn encode_atoms(&mut self, op: &OpAtom) {
self.set_opcode(0xec00);
self.set_mem_order(&op.mem_order);
self.set_dst(op.dst);
self.set_reg_src(8..16, op.addr);
self.set_reg_src(20..28, op.data);
self.set_field(
28..30,
match op.atom_type {
AtomType::U32 => 0_u8,
AtomType::I32 => 1_u8,
AtomType::U64 => 2_u8,
AtomType::I64 => 3_u8,
/* TODO: do something about ATOMS.F{32,64} */
other => panic!("ATOMS.{other} not supported on SM50"),
},
);
assert_eq!(op.addr_offset % 4, 0);
self.set_field(30..52, op.addr_offset / 4);
self.set_atom_op(52..56, op.atom_op);
}
fn encode_atom(&mut self, op: &OpAtom) {
match op.mem_space {
MemSpace::Global(_) => self.encode_atomg(op),
MemSpace::Local => panic!("Atomics do not support local"),
MemSpace::Shared => self.encode_atoms(op),
}
}
